- NASA launches the Parker Solar Probe to study the outer corona of the Sun.
- In the Saudi Arabian-led intervention in Yemen, Saudi armed forces bomb a school bus in Dahyan, killing at least 50 people, including 29 children.
- Amado Boudou (pictured), former vice president of Argentina, is sentenced to almost six years in prison for corruption.
- Saudi Arabia expels the Canadian ambassador after receiving criticism of its treatment of rights activists.
- A 6.9 magnitude earthquake strikes Lombok, Indonesia, killing more than 380 people after its 6.4 magnitude foreshock killed at least 20 others a week prior.
